Key Responsibilities
- Conduct comprehensive code reviews across multiple systems and projects.
- Ensure code quality, maintainability, and compliance with best practices.
- Identify and document technical issues, security risks, and architectural gaps.
- Collaborate with developers to refine coding standards and frameworks.
- Define and maintain code review processes and metrics.
- Mentor teams on clean code, performance optimization, and secure coding.
- Provide technical validation and support for QA/QC activities.
Qualifications
- Bachelor's Degree in Computer Science, Software Engineering, or related discipline.
- 7+ years of experience in software development or code review.
- Strong understanding of software architecture, design patterns, and best practices.
- Skilled in Java, Python, C#, JavaScript, or Go.
- Familiar with CI/CD pipelines, Git, and automated code analysis tools (e.g., SonarQube, Jenkins).
- Knowledge of secure coding standards (OWASP, ISO
- Excellent communication and documentation skills.
- Experience in banking, fintech, or enterprise systems preferred.